
Mintop Solution
Minoxidil topical solution for hereditary hair loss. It lengthens the growing phase of hair follicles, which can slow thinning.
Mintop Solution details
- Condition
- Androgenetic Alopecia
- Alternative names
- minoxidil
- Therapeutic class
- Direct-Acting Vasodilator
- Pharmacological class
- Topical Hair Growth Stimulant
- Contraindications
- unexplained hair loss; broken or inflamed scalp skin
- Minor side effects
- local itching; scalp dryness; mild scaling
- Moderate side effects
- hypertrichosis; burning sensation; local dermatitis
- Serious side effects
- severe contact hypersensitivity, requires immediate medical attention
- Dosage forms
- Topical Solution
- Administration route
- Cutaneous use
- Supply category
- Pharmacy medicine (P), available from a pharmacist without a prescription
- Manufacturer
- Dr. Reddy's Laboratories
- Onset Time
- 2–4 months
- Storage instructions
- Store below 25°C.
- Age restrictions
- Approved for adults.
- Pregnancy and breastfeeding
- Pregnancy: Use if benefit outweighs risk. Breastfeeding: Consult a doctor.

Mechanism of action
Promotes local blood flow and opens cell potassium channels, extending the growing anagen cycle of hair follicles.
